Quick Answer: Bethlehem PA Housing Market 2026
The Redfin Data Center city row for the rolling three months ending 2026-06-30 shows a $309,332 median sale price (+3.11% YoY), 8 median days on market, and 171 homes sold. Zillow Research city ZHVI is $366,727 (+3.68% YoY) as of 2026-06-30. The 99.8% sale-to-list ratio shown below is older supplemental context, not a June refresh field. Bethlehem Neighborhood Price Breakdown
Bethlehem's market is not uniform. Prices vary significantly by neighborhood, reflecting the city's distinct character from the pre-war South Side row homes to the Moravian historic district on the North Side.
| Neighborhood | Median Price | Stock Type | Investor Activity |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Bethlehem (South Side) | ~$245,000 | Row homes & twins, 1890s–1930s | 🔴 Very High |
| Central Bethlehem | ~$300,000 | Victorian-era, brick row houses | 🟡 High |
| Northeast Bethlehem | ~$325,000 | Postwar ranch homes, 1950s–1980s | 🟡 Medium |
| Historic District / North Side | $380K–$450K+ | 18th–19th c. Moravian stone/brick | 🟢 Lower |
| Fountain Hill (adjacent borough) | ~$228,000 | Cape Cods, townhomes, twins | 🔴 High |
| West Side | $250K–$290,000 | Row homes, mid-century mix | 🟡 High |
| Bethlehem Township (adjacent) | $340K–$390,000 | Suburban single-family, 1970s–2000s | 🟢 Low |
Sources: Redfin neighborhood pages (South Bethlehem, Central Bethlehem, Northeast Bethlehem); Lehigh Valley Just Listed (Fountain Hill); BestNeighborhood.org. Data was reviewed as older supplemental context; not updated in the June source refresh.

According to the U.S. Census Bureau, 30.8% of Bethlehem's housing units are attached structures (row homes and twins), the majority built between 1890 and 1930 for Bethlehem Steel workers.
These homes — while often charming — frequently have deferred maintenance: original cast-iron plumbing, pre-1950 electrical, unreinforced masonry, and 100-year-old rooflines. A property in this condition typically requires $15,000-$40,000 in work before it competes for retail buyers. Bethlehem PA Transfer Tax — The Full Breakdown
According to City of Bethlehem Ordinance Article 335, Bethlehem charges the standard Pennsylvania local transfer tax rate of 1%. Combined with the 1% Pennsylvania state realty transfer tax, the total is 2% of the sale price.
| Component | Rate | Who Pays | On $309,332 Home |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pennsylvania State RTT | 1.0% | Split 50/50 | $3,093 total |
| City of Bethlehem Local RTT | 1.0% | Split 50/50 | $3,093 total |
| TOTAL | 2.0% | Seller pays 1% | $6,187 total ($3,093 seller) |

Northampton County Recording Fees
According to the Northampton County Recorder of Deeds (669 Washington Street, Easton, PA 18042), the recording fee schedule for real estate transactions includes:
| Document | Fee |
|---|---|
| Deed (first 4 pages) | $75.25 |
| Mortgage (first 4 pages) | $75.25 |
| Satisfaction of Mortgage | $60.75 |
| Assignment/Release of Mortgage | $60.75 |
| Pages over 4 | $2.00 each |
| Parcel Certification Fee | $10.00 per parcel |
